Moira Sound is a physical feature (bay) in Prince of Wales-Hyder (CA) Borough.

Description: | extends from junction of its South and West Arms, NE to Clarence Strait, on SE coast of Prince of Wales I., Alex. Arch. |
History: | "Named by Captain Vancouver (1798, v. 2, p. 206), Royal Navy (RN) in August, 1793, ""after the noble Earl of that title."" See Apodaca, Bocas de." |
